原文:Nhibernate 3.0 cookbook学习笔记 创建一个加密类

为数据库中的关键字段进行加密是必不可少的,特别是一些用户密码,银行卡账号等。现在我们来说一下如何在Nhibernate中创建一个加密类来为数据库中的关键字段加密。 创建一个接口:IEncryptor 再创建一个继承它的子类:SymmetricEncryptorBase 再创建一个类:DESEncryptor 再新建一个类:EncryptedString,通过这个类来调用前面的DESEncrypto ...

2012-05-28 00:07 6 1396 推荐指数:

查看详情

学习笔记——初学NHibernate

了解ORM   首先来解释下ORM对象关系映射(Object Relational Mapping),是一种为了解决面向对象与关系数据库存在的互不匹配的现象的技术。 一般以第三方插件的形式,在程序 ...

Sun Oct 06 20:24:00 CST 2013 0 2846
NHibernate学习笔记之一,Hello world!

NHibernate一个面向.NET环境的对象/关系数据库映射框架,主要应用在数据持久层,和其它的ORM框架一样用来把对象模型表示的对象映射到基于SQL的关系模型数据结构中去。Nhibernate 来源于非常优秀的基于Java的Hibernate 关系型持久化框架。Nhibernate支持多种 ...

Wed Sep 12 04:36:00 CST 2012 4 2764
Qt学习笔记04:创建按钮--QPushButton

☁️前几天学习Qt没找到好的资源,停了一会,挺难的,比Python的Wx和Tk都要难,昨天晚上去B站找到了资源,还有脚本之家的一些文档还有C语言中文网的。 资源: 哔哩哔哩:https://www.bilibili.com/video/BV1g4411H78N?p=6看得人 ...

Sun May 10 00:40:00 CST 2020 0 1343
vue3.0学习笔记(一)

一、搭建工作环境环境   1、从node.js官网下载相应版本进行安装即可 https://nodejs.org/zh-cn/download/,安装完成后在命令行输入 node -v 如果可以查 ...

Tue May 21 19:15:00 CST 2019 0 894
vue3.0学习笔记(一)

部分目录文件解读: .circleci文件夹(config.yml文件)// Circleci的配置文件 Circleci是一个持续集成/部署的服务,可以绑定Github,只有代码有变更,就会自动抓取,并根据你的配置,提供运行环境,执行测试、构建和部署。 .vscode ...

Fri Oct 11 02:53:00 CST 2019 0 906
django学习笔记【002】创建一个django app

2.3.3 1、创建一个名叫polls的app 2、给polls这个app编写一个视图、也就是为polls/views.py 中增加相应输出html的文件;修改后polls/views.py 的内容如下: 3、为视图关联一个url ...

Fri Feb 03 19:33:00 CST 2017 0 1894
OpenGL_Qt学习笔记之_01(创建一个OpenGL窗口)

很早就想学opengl的,一直没时间,今天心血来潮初步了解了下opengl。 Opengl是对2D和3D图形支持很好,有非常多的优化函数,因为opengl的主要目标是图形功能函数上,所以它对图形界面的支持并不完善。当然了,作为一个跨平台的开源库,这是能理解的,因为每个平台开发界面用的工具 ...

Fri Dec 08 04:56:00 CST 2017 0 3287
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M